Dr Chinnapat Panwisawas is a Senior Lecturer in Materials and Solid Mechanics at Queen Mary University of London, where he also serves as Deputy Director of Graduate Studies and Director of the Materials Science and Engineering Programme. His research focuses on multi-scale computational materials engineering, integrating physics-based and data-driven AI frameworks to advance additive manufacturing for aerospace, automotive, biomedical, and green energy applications.
- Education: PhD in Metallurgy (2013, University of Birmingham), BSc in Physics (2008, Chulalongkorn University)
Dr Panwisawas' work spans additive manufacturing, digital twin technologies, and data-centric engineering. He employs integrated computational materials engineering (ICME) to optimize processes like laser powder bed fusion and directed energy deposition, addressing challenges in porosity, microstructural control, and material sustainability. His research aligns with UK net-zero targets, emphasizing eco-friendly manufacturing solutions.
Recent publications highlight multi-material additive manufacturing, functionally graded alloys, and AI-driven process optimization. His team collaborates with Rolls-Royce, ISIS Neutron Source, and global institutions, securing grants from Innovate UK, Royal Society, and EPSRC. Awards include Fellowships from FIMechE, FInstP, and inclusion in the Top 2% of World Scientists in Materials (2022–2024).

Dr Panwisawas supervises PhD students in projects ranging from 3D-printed prostate tissue imaging to ultralightweight mechanical metamaterials. His grants include the NEXTA Co-creation Centre and DISTorting Aerospace Manufacturing Boundaries initiatives, supporting innovation in titanium and multi-material AM.
